카테고리 없음

구글 서치 콘솔 LCP 문제: 2.5초 초과(모바일) 해결 방법 정리

왕코인 2023. 4. 16.
반응형

LCP (Largest Contentful Paint)는 웹 페이지의 로딩 성능을 측정하는 지표 중 하나입니다. LCP가 2.5초 초과되면, 페이지 로딩 속도가 느려져 사용자 경험에 악영향을 미칠 수 있습니다. 특히 모바일 환경에서는 느린 인터넷 속도, 제한된 처리 능력 등으로 인해 더욱 중요한 지표가 됩니다.

 

구글서치콘솔 오류

LCP를 개선하기 위해서는 다음과 같은 방법들을 고려할 수 있습니다.

 

이미지 최적화: LCP의 가장 큰 요소 중 하나는 이미지입니다. 이미지를 최적화하여 크기를 줄이고 압축률을 높여 로딩 속도를 빠르게 할 수 있습니다.

이미지 최적화: 이미지는 웹 페이지에서 가장 큰 용량을 차지하는 요소 중 하나입니다. 이미지를 최적화하여 용량을 줄이고 압축률을 높이면 로딩 속도가 빨라집니다. 이를 위해서는 다음과 같은 방법들을 고려할 수 있습니다.


이미지 크기 줄이기: 이미지 크기를 줄이면 용량이 작아지기 때문에 로딩 속도가 빨라집니다. 이를 위해서는 이미지 편집 도구를 사용하여 이미지 크기를 조정하거나, 이미지의 품질을 낮추는 방법을 고려할 수 있습니다.


이미지 포맷 변경: JPEG, PNG, WebP 등 이미지 포맷 중에서는 WebP가 가장 압축률이 높아 로딩 속도가 빠릅니다. 하지만 모든 브라우저가 WebP를 지원하지는 않기 때문에, 브라우저 호환성을 고려하여 JPEG 또는 PNG로 변환할 수 있습니다.


Lazy loading: 화면에 보이지 않는 이미지는 로딩하지 않고, 스크롤을 내리면서 화면에 나타날 때에만 로딩하는 방법입니다. 이를 통해 초기 로딩 속도를 개선할 수 있습니다.

 

캐시 사용: 웹 페이지에서 자주 사용하는 파일은 캐시에 저장하여 빠르게 로딩할 수 있도록 합니다.

캐시 사용: 브라우저는 웹 페이지에서 자주 사용하는 파일을 캐시에 저장하여 다음에 해당 파일을 요청할 때 로딩 시간을 줄일 수 있습니다. 이를 위해서는 캐시 제어 헤더를 사용하여 브라우저가 캐시를 사용하도록 설정해야 합니다.

JavaScript 최적화: JavaScript는 브라우저에서 처리해야 하는 작업이 많기 때문에 로딩 시간을 늘릴 수 있습니다.

이를 개선하기 위해서는 다음과 같은 방법들을 고려할 수 있습니다.

JavaScript 파일 최소화: JavaScript 파일의 크기를 줄여서 로딩 시간을 단축할 수 있습니다. 이를 위해서는 JavaScript 파일을 최소화하고, 압축하여 전송하는 방법을 고려할 수 있습니다.
지연 로딩: 페이지가 로딩되는 동안 필요한 JavaScript 코드만 로딩하여 초기 로딩 속도를 개선하는 방법입니다. 이를 위해서는 필요한 JavaScript 코드를 모듈화하여 필요할 때만 로딩하도록 구현할 수 있습니다.

 

서버 리소스 최적화: 서버 리소스를 최적화하여 페이지 로딩 속도를 높일 수 있습니다.

이를 위해 CSS와 JavaScript 파일을 최소화하고 브라우저 캐시를 사용합니다.

 

 

CDN 사용: CDN(Content Delivery Network)을 사용하여 웹 페이지의 로딩 속도를 높일 수 있습니다.

콘텐츠 전달 네트워크(CDN) 사용: CDN은 웹 페이지에서 사용되는 정적 파일(이미지, CSS, JavaScript 등)을 전 세계 여러 지역의 서버에 캐시하여 사용자가 가까운 서버에서 해당 파일을 로딩할 수 있도록 해줍니다. 이를 통해 로딩 속도를 개선할 수 있습니다.
서버 사양 업그레이드: 서버 사양이 낮을 경우, 느린 서버 응답 속도로 인해 로딩 속도가 느려질 수 있습니다. 서버 사양을 업그레이드하여 서버 응답 속도를 개선하면 로딩 속도를 개선할 수 있습니다.
gzip 압축 사용: gzip은 서버에서 전송되는 파일을 압축하여 파일 용량을 줄이고, 전송 시간을 단축할 수 있습니다. 이를 통해 로딩 속도를 개선할 수 있습니다.

반응형

댓글